jsonTreeViewer - 一款轻量级JSON格式化与查看器
jsonTreeViewer是一款基于纯JavaScript编写的开源项目,主要使用了JavaScript、HTML和CSS三种编程语言。
核心功能
该项目包含两个主要部分:jsonTreeViewer和jsonTree库。jsonTreeViewer是一个简单的JSON格式化查看器,基于jsonTree库构建而成。jsonTree库则是一个轻量级的纯JavaScript库,用于将JSON对象转换成易于查看的树形结构。
主要功能包括:
- 加载并格式化JSON字符串。
- 通过点击节点标签展开或折叠单个节点,可通过按住CTRL/META键实现递归展开或折叠。
- 提供按钮来展开或折叠所有树节点。
- 通过按住ALT键点击节点标签,可以标记或取消标记节点。
- 通过按住SHIFT键点击节点标签,可以显示节点的JSONPath。
最近更新的功能
根据项目的更新日志,最近的更新可能包括以下内容:
- 对项目的文档和示例进行了优化,使得用户更容易理解和使用项目。
- 可能修复了一些已知的bug,提高了库的稳定性和可靠性。
- 增强了用户交互体验,例如改进了节点展开和折叠的行为。
项目通过不断迭代,持续优化用户体验和功能实用性,为开发者提供了一个简单易用的JSON格式化和查看工具。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考